How a dc motor is controlled using arduino and l293d. The l293d datasheet specifies that this device is a monolithic integrated high voltage, high current four channel driver designed to accept standard dtl or ttl logic levels and drive inductive loads such as relays solenoides, dc and stepping motors and switching power transistors. This tutorial of robo india explains how to control dc motor using l293d ic motor driver with arduino. How to use the l298 motor driver module arduino tutorial. It receives signals from arduino uno board based on the information passed by the ir sensors. Texas instruments dual hbridge motor drivers l293d. Each channel on the module can deliver up to 600ma to the dc motor. Lets begin our tutorial and learn how ic l293darduinogear motor interface is done. If you want to control an dc motor that can run forward or reverse you can do that in many ways. Arduino dc motor control with l293d motor driver ic youtube. Arduino l293d motor driver shield tutorial arduino. L293d motor driver stepper motor driver module for. Should i use l293d motor driverl298n motor driverl293d motor driver shield i am using n20 microgear motor with following rating.
Hope you liked the tutorial on l293d expansion module for arduino. It comes in various forms, this one is an expansion shield, which means it stacks on top of the arduino. Another rather common driver is the l298n motor driver but unlike the l293d driver, this one mainly controls dc motors. There is no difference in program or connection vice while using the l293d ic directly or through a module. In this tutorial, you are going to learn about arduino l298n motor driver module interfacing. In this project we will control the dc motor using single ic called l293d. Each channel of this module has the maximum current of 1. Jan 29, 2018 this is the arduino tutorial video to explain how you can run two dc motors and control the speed and direction using l298n driver module with arduino. It can drive 4 dc motor in one direction, or drive 2 dc motor in both direction. And how to use l293d motor driver moduleshield with arduino. This driver module is based on the l293 dual motor driver chip which is designed to provide bidirectional drive currents of up to 1 a at voltages from 4. Add to cart add to cart add to cart add to cart add to cart add to cart customer rating.
I want to run 4 microgear motor for an rc car with arduino. L293d motor driver shield for arduino this motor driver shield is based on l293d motor driver chip which is designed to provide bidirectional drive currents of up to 1. This is the arduino tutorial video to explain how you can run two dc motors and control the speed and direction using l298n driver module with arduino. The l293d is designed to provide bidirectional drive currents of up to 600 ma per channel at voltages from 4. This driver can be used in industrial applications as well as some of the models can sustain up to 30a of current. How to use the l293d motor driver ic ardumotive arduino greek. How to control dc motor with l298n driver and arduino. Home arduino how to control dc motor with l298n driver and arduino. This dual bidirectional motor driver is based on the very popular l298 dual hbridge motor driver ic. The l293d is a typical motor driver which can drive 2 dc motors simultaneously. This arduino compatible motor driver shield is a fullfeatured product that it can be used to drive 4 dc motor or two 4wire steppers and two 5v servos. L293d motor driver module is a medium power motor driver perfect for driving dc motors and stepper motors. Dual hbridge motor driver for dc or steppers 600ma l293d this is a very useful chip.
The 293d is designed to provide bidirectional drive current up to 600ma a voltage from 5v to 36v. The shield contains two l293d motor drivers and one gn74hc595n level shifter ic. Tutorial l298n dual motor controller module 2a and arduino in this tutorial well explain how to use our l298n hbridge dual motor controller module 2a with arduino. It is pin compatible with adafruit motor shield and hence one can use adafruits library functions. This handy tutorial will teach you how to work a dc motor with an arduino and an l293d motor driver with some quick connections and a bit of code. In this arduino tutorial let us see how to drive motors using l293d with arduino uno. L293d is a 16 pin motor driver ic consist of quadruple half h drivers. L293d motor driver arduino tutorial dc motor control using arduino. A high power motor driver that can sustain up to 12a. Control the speed of brushless dc motor using arduino and bluetooth module hc05. Smakn dualh bridge l293d 4 dc motor driver module for arduino robot 4wd smart car.
It lets you drive 2 stepper motor or 4 dc motors with an arduino, controlling the speed and direction of each one independently. L293d is a monolithic integrated, high voltage, high current, 4channel driver. How to control dc motors with l293d motor driver youtube video that ive uploaded recently. L293d motor driver shield for arduino open impulseopen. L293d motor driver module arduino tutorial dc motor control. This is designed to provide bidirectional drive currents at voltages from 5 v to 36 v. It drives the dc motor and stepper with the l293d, and it drives the servo with arduino pin9 and pin10. L293d motor driver arduino robo india tutorials learn. It is a synchronous regenerative drive with ultrasonic switching capability. The l293d is a dualchannel hbridge motor driver capable of driving a pair of dc motors or single stepper motor.
In this tutorial, im going to show you how to control a servo motor with the hbridge motor driver. Before moving towards the detailed study and use about l293d module read these posts about. Buy l293d motor driver module online at the best price in. By using this module you can control direction and speed of dc motors. Using just three arduino pins it can drive 2 servo and 4 dc motor with onboard ports. Jun 05, 2018 the l293d is a motor control module or an l293 motor driver. The l293d is a motor control module or an l293 motor driver. As the shield comes with two l293d motor driver chipsets, that means it can individually drive up to four dc motors making it ideal for building fourwheel robot platforms. Control the speed of brushless dc motor using bluetooth. Connect your arduinos gnd to both gnd pins on the same side of the l293d. The l298n module has a very famous l298 motor driver ic which is the main part of this module. The vs pin on the motor driver supplies power to the motor. The l293d motor drivers output channels for the motor a and b are brought out to pins out1,out2 and out3,out4 respectively.
L293d motor driver shield for arduino buy online at low. The motor driver is a module for motors that allows you to control the working speed and direction of two motors simultaneously. Driving a dc motor with an arduino and the l293d motor driver. This shield can control servos, dc motors and stepper motors. Basically this means using this chip you can use dc motors and power supplies of up to 36 volts, thats some pretty big motors and the chip can supply a maximum current of 600ma per channel, the l293d chip is also what. Sainsmart l293d motor drive shield for arduino duemilanove. This l293d motor driver is a 4channel driver with an arduino shield form factor. L293d motor driver and controlling motor using pwm nodemcu. Motor driver l293d driver module is a medium power motor driver perfect for driving dc motors and stepper motors. But i want to tell you the simplest way to drive dc motor. So be careful with choosing the proper motor according to its nominal voltage and current. L298n hbridge motor driver module is use to control two dc motor or a single bipolor stepper motor. This l293d shield for arduino, particularly arduino uno, ctuno, is perfect for driving 4 brush motors or 2 stepper motors and it can even supports rc servo motor.
Dc, stepper and servo motors using an arduino l293d motor driver. L293d motor control module tutorial run motors off the arduino. L293d motor driver arduino interfacing driver ic l293d is available as module and arduino shield. This module also features an optocoupler, in order to protect the mcu from electromagnetic interference.
L293d motor driver shield for arduino calcutta electronics. This ic is powerful enough to control dc motor with low current. Controlling the l293d unomega shield with dc motors. May 16, 2018 driver ic l293d is available as module and arduino shield. Here, l293d motor driver module is being used to drive the motors of the robot. If your motor requires more voltage than your arduino can provide, you can hook up an external battery or battery pack.
This module will allow you to easily and independently control two motors of up to 2a each in both directions. It can control both speed and spinning direction of two dc motors. L293d motor control shield motor drive expansion board for. Jan 30, 2018 home arduino how to control dc motor with l298n driver and arduino.
This allows you to control the speed and direction of two dc motors, or. L293d adapter board can be used as dual dc motor driver or bipolar stepper motor driver. Basically this means using this chip you can use dc motors and power supplies of up to 36 volts, thats some pretty big motors and the chip can supply a maximum current of 600ma per channel, the l293d chip is. The l293d motor driver shield is one of the best way for controlling dc, servo and stepper motors especially if you are using arduino uno or mega in projects like robotics and cnc. We can control 4 motors with the shield so there are two l293d ic s used. Make a line follower robot using l293d motor driver module. It also equiped with serial to parallel expansion ic 74hc595. Another rather common driver is the l298n motor driver but unlike the. The module will allow you to control the speed and direction of two dc motors. L293d consist of two hbridge designed using 4transistor circuit that helps us to reverse the direction of rotation and to control the speed of the dc motor. The l293d is a dedicated module to fit in arduino uno r3 board, and arduino mega, it is actually a motor driver shield that has full featured arduino shield can be used to drive 2 to 6 dc motor and 4 wire stepper motor and it has 2 set of pins to drive a servo. Should i use l293d motor driver l298n motor driver l293d motor driver shield i am using n20 microgear motor with following rating. Engeniuslab introduces the l293d motor driving module is a medium power motor driver perfect for driving dc motor and stepper motors.
We can easily control 4 motors with this driver module. I have used this shield for making a remote control robot that i will show to at the end. We can control the direction and speed of dc motor 12v by arduino using l293d motor driver. This motor driver is designed and developed based on l293d ic. Hackafmotorshield is an arduino nano friendly ready to use robotics platform. It can simultaneously control the direction and speed of two dc motors. Driving a dc motor with an arduino and the l293d motor. L293ds input2, output2, gnd, gnd are all connected to arduinos gnd. Hack af l293d motor driverservo shield for arduino nano.
Motor driver ics are primarily used in autonomous robotics. L293d motor driver modules usually come with an inbuilt lm317 voltage regulator circuit or similar voltage regulating circuit, along with connectors. Arduino gear motor interface using ic l293d motor driver. Arduino l293d motor driver shield tutorial arduino project hub. L293d motor shield is een zeer nuttige shield met standaard componenten. If you are planning on assembling your new robot friend, you will eventually want to learn about controlling dc motors. L293d is a motor driver ic used to control motors with a microcontroller. Controlling dc motors using arduino is very interesting. Arduino servo motor control with motor driver shield l293d. This module uses the pwm method to control the speed of dc motors. L293 optoisolated motor driver module open impulse. This is a dual fullbridge driver designed to drive inductive loads such as relays, solenoids, dc and stepper motors. The l293d is a monolithic integrated, high voltage, high current, 4channel driver.
This l293d motor driverservo shield for arduino is probably one of the most versatile features in the market. You can connect two dc motors having voltages between 4. L203d is a monolithic integrated that has a feature to adopt high voltage, high. Arduino l293d motor driver shield tutorial electropeak. The l293d device is quadruple highcurrent halfh driver. Driving the servos with l293d shield is as easy as pie. Consuming such a high current at standby is too high. The data from the sensors ir sensors is transmitted to the arduino uno and it gives corresponding signals to the l293d motor driver module. It can drive 4 dc motors on and off, or drive 2 dc motors with directional and speed control.
Motor driver circuit with some power saving features. L293d motor drive shield for arduino cytron technologies. Driver ic l293d is available as module and arduino shield. The l293d datasheet specifies that this device is a monolithic integrated high voltage, high current four channel driver designed to accept standard dtl or ttl logic levels and drive inductive loads such as relays solenoides, dc and stepping motors and. Het bevat twee l293d motor drivers en een 74hc595 schuifregister. L293d motor driver shield for arduino buy online at low price. If you dont know what is hbridge and l293d you can simply read this. Finally, connect output 1 and output 2 of the l293d to your motor pins. Useful in robotics application, bidirectional dc motor controller and stepper motor driver. How to use the l293d motor driver ic ardumotive arduino. Buy l293d motor driver module online at the best price in india. Tutorial l298n dual motor controller module 2a and arduino. L293d motor driver stepper motor driver module for arduino. One of the easiest and inexpensive way to control dc motors is to interface l293d motor driver ic with arduino.
And how to use l293d motor driver module shield with arduino. Each channel on the ic can deliver up to 600ma to the dc motor. Jul 14, 2017 how to drive the motor with the motor driver. The l293d is a 16pin motor driver ic which can control a set of two dc motors simultaneously in any direction. L293d shield is a driver board based on l293 ic, which can drive 4 dc motors and 2 stepper or servo motors at the same time. A motor driver ic named l293d is used here for interfacing the gear motor with arduino. Two l293d on board offering bidirectional control for 4. This instructable is the written version of my arduino. L293 optoisolated motor driver module open impulseopen. Controlling dc motors with arduino arduino l298n tutorial. Feb 15, 2018 controlling dc motors using arduino is very interesting. Buy electronics components, projects, modules, boards, sensors at best price. L293d motor control module tutorial run motors off the.